Residents of Makindye Ssabagabo zone had a free drama recently when a man identified as Sula dressed himself in gomesi to avoid being arrested for not paying musolo (graduated tax).

KCC law enforcement officials had sealed off all the main roads of Makindye to net tax defaulters. Sula had an appointment in town which was to earn him money. He put on his wife’s gomesi and wrapped his head with a piece of cloth, applied lipstick, eye pencil and disguised his appearance completely. With this beauty, Sula picked the wife’s handbag, and set off.

When he reached the musolo road block, his voice betrayed him when she was asked to produce his tax ticket. He answered in a deep voice that he was a house wife. This drew suspicion among the law enforcement officers and onlookers. To cover up his shame, Sula folded his gomesi and took off.
